“…27 But affected by various harsh working environments, sensor fault is one of the most common faults in the system, and it is also the fault which is easily overlooked when the system is abnormal. 28,29 It is pointed out by Li et al 28 that there are a great amount of sensors in the modern industrial plants and the fault diagnosis of the sensor fault plays an important role in the system safety and optimal operation process. Considering the problem of multiple sensor fault detection, isolation and identification for the multivariate dynamic systems, a fault diagnosis method based on the basic sensor fault matrix is proposed and the effectiveness of this method is verified by comparing two conventional PCA-based contribution plots.…”
